Bloom filter sizing here is wrong. You're computing bits-per-key from the total keyspace of Marlinette, not the hot set in front of the Pexley store, so false-positive rate balloons under load and we hammer disk anyway. Also, don't rebuild the filter on every compaction; rebuild on the threshold schedule. Fix the hash count too — two is not enough. Use the agreed constants, listed below for reference.

tuning table, yajog-yahof:
BUDGETS = {
    "lamvan": 303,
    "wenox": 460,
    "fenvan": 525,
}

Connection Pooling at Fernhollow

Quick primer for your review: our services talk to Postgres through the Larkwell pooler, capped at 40 connections per pod. Idle connections recycle after 90 seconds, and credentials rotate nightly via the vault job. Nothing connects directly — if you spot a bypass, flag it loudly. To spin up a local pool and verify the rotation flow yourself, you'll need the deploy key we've provisioned for reviewers, shown just below.

deploy key for kajof-fajop: bky6_gDHw9Q

## Changelog — Font vendoring defaults changed

As of this release, the Bracken UI build no longer fetches third-party fonts at build time. All typefaces used by the Lanternwell suite are now vendored into the repo under a dedicated assets directory, and the fetch step is skipped by default. If you're onboarding, nothing to install — the fonts travel with the checkout. The build flags controlling this behavior are listed below.

settings of hadup-yafog:
LAMAEL_PIN=3761
LAMAEL_TENANT=istmir
LAMAEL_METRICS_HOST=metrics.lamael.plorvasys.test
LAMAEL_SEAL=seal_8ea68500
LAMAEL_STANDBY_TEAM=fraok

Ticket #4417 — Expired credentials: PayLoop retry worker

The PayLoop retry worker started failing at 02:10 with auth errors. Idempotency keys are generated correctly, but the worker can't submit retries, so duplicate-charge protection is currently untested in prod. Retries are queued, not lost; once credentials are restored the backlog will drain and idempotency keys will dedupe anything already processed. The old service key expired yesterday and nobody rotated it. A replacement has been issued — configure the worker with the key below.

service key, yadug-bajog: zpat3_pou